SCHW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

1,874 of the 6,860 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Charles Schwab (SCHW)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$105B — up 30% from $80.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 285 funds opened new SCHW positions and 121 closed out — a net gain of 164 holders — while 763 added to existing stakes and 640 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$1.57B.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$239M.
